Abstract

An electronic device includes a first shell, a second shell latching with the first shell, and a sealing member positioned between the first shell and the second shell. The first shell has a first sidewall, and the second shell has a second sidewall. The sealing member is elastic, and includes a first sealing portion and a second sealing portion. A first sealing slot and a second sealing slot are defined between the first sealing portion and the second sealing portion. The first sidewall is received in the first sealing slot and contacting with the sidewall of the first sealing slot firmly. The second sidewall is received in the second sealing slot and contacting with the sidewall of the second sealing slot firmly. The electronic device is water proof and can save material.

Description of the Invention: [Technical Field of the Invention] [0001] The present invention relates to an electronic device, and more particularly to an electronic device having a waterproof function. [Prior Art] [0002] There are many electronic components inside the electronic device, so it is necessary to pay attention to waterproof during use, and to prevent water from immersing inside and damaging the electronic components therein. Referring to FIG. 1 , a teach pendant 100 according to an embodiment of the present invention includes a first housing 10 , a second housing 30 that is engaged with the first housing 10 , and a first housing 10 and a second housing. a first sealing member 50 between the body 30, a display screen 70 mounted on the first housing 10, and a second sealing member 80 on the first housing 10. [0009] Please refer to FIG. 1 and FIG. 2 at the same time. As shown in FIG. 5, the first housing 10 includes a first bottom wall 11 , a first side wall 13 extending perpendicularly from a periphery of the first bottom wall 11 , and a resisting portion 15 adjacent to the first side wall 13 . The first bottom wall 11 has a first edge 111 and the first edge 111 is a curved surface. A screw hole (not shown) is also formed in the first bottom wall 11. The first side wall 13 has a thickness A, and the first side wall 13 has a connecting portion 131 connected to the first bottom wall 11. The width X of the connecting portion 131 is greater than the first 098143485. Form No. A0101 Page 4 of 18 00 00 00 00 00 00 00 00 201124034 The thickness A of the side wall 13. [0010] The second housing 30 includes a second bottom wall 31 and a second side wall 33 extending perpendicularly from a periphery of the second bottom wall 31. The second bottom wall 31 has a second edge 311, and the second edge 311 is a curved surface. A screw hole 313 is also formed in the second bottom wall 31. The second side wall 33 has a thickness B, and the second side wall 33 has a connecting portion 331 connected to the second bottom wall 31. The width Y of the connecting portion 331 is greater than the thickness B of the second side wall 33. [0011] Please refer to FIG. 2 to FIG. 5. The first sealing member 50 is a closed annular structure surrounding the first housing 10 and the second housing 30, and is made of an elastic material. In the present embodiment, the first sealing member 50 is made of rubber. The first sealing member 50 includes a first sealing portion 51 and a second sealing portion 53, and a first sealing groove 55 and a second sealing groove 57 are formed between the first sealing portion 51 and the second sealing portion 53. Referring to FIG. 3, FIG. 5 and FIG. 6, the first sealing portion 51 includes a connecting portion 511 and a clamping portion 513. The clamping portion 513 and the second sealing portion 53 are respectively located on opposite sides of the connecting portion 511. The connecting portion 511 separates the first seal groove 55 and the second seal groove 57, and the longitudinal width of the joint portion 511 before being compressed is 〇 L. The first sealing groove 55 and the second sealing groove 57 are surrounded by the connecting portion 511 of the first sealing portion 51, the clamping portion 513 and the second sealing portion 53, so the groove walls of the first sealing groove 55 and the second sealing groove 57 That is, it is a part of the clamping zone 513 and the second sealing part 53. The opening width of the first sealing groove 55 before being compressed is C, the opening width of the second sealing groove 57 before being compressed is D, and the opening width C before the first sealing groove 55 is not compressed is smaller than the thickness of the first side wall 13. A. The opening width D before the second sealing groove 57 is not compressed is smaller than the thickness B of the second side wall 33.
